Output ef709fe57d0428f768d3814319adfcd7af781293f5abfae4dbdf6fc17f37f90f:15

value
748857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d64d9bb0d83d92bdb691afa8ad7df7ddeddfa2 OP_EQUAL
address
35ENKsronEzkQKQCQtQ4MtL9zkP3VaH4Vc
transaction
ef709fe57d0428f768d3814319adfcd7af781293f5abfae4dbdf6fc17f37f90f
spent
true